Bio

Kenny Cetera's Chicago Experience is a Chicago tribute led by Kenny Cetera, whose credits include vocals on Chicago 17 and touring with Chicago. He also recorded with Peter Cetera, Richard Marx, Kenny Rogers, Julio Iglesias, Bill Champlin, Agnetha Faltskog, and David Foster.

The city of Chicago has produced some of the greatest artists and bands in the music world, and hailing from the south side of that town, Kenny Cetera is no exception.

Born into a family of vast musical talents, where listening to his mother and siblings constantly singing, harmonizing and rehearsing was commonplace. Kenny says “Being a singer was inevitable for me.” Kenny has recorded with Chicago, Peter Cetera, Richard Marx, Kenny Rogers, Julio Iglesias, Bill Champlin, Agnetha Faltskog (of “ABBA” fame), and producer David Foster.

In 1984, Kenny added his unmistakable tenor vocals to several songs on the Chicago 17 album – including the chart- topping “You’re the Inspiration,” “Stay The Night,” “Along Comes A Woman” and “Prima Donna” and was quickly recruited by the band to hit the road for one of the most memorable tours in their history. Adding a vocal element that the band never had live before, two Cetera voices together. Kenny also played drums, percussion and keyboards on that tour and became a large part of the stage show, a fan-favorite, and permanently ingrained in the musical heritage of CHICAGO.
